Abstract

Introduction Dental caries remains a significant public health concern, particularly among children with special health care needs, who are at increased risk due to challenges in oral hygiene maintenance and limited access to dental care. Silver diamine fluoride (SDF) is widely used to arrest caries but is associated with undesirable black staining. Nano silver fluoride (NSF) has been introduced as a potential alternative, offering effective caries management without aesthetic drawbacks. Hence, this randomized controlled clinical trial aimed to evaluate and compare the cariostatic and antibacterial efficacy of NSF and SDF in children with special health care needs (CSHCN) aged 4-12 years. Methods Forty-two children with mild to moderate intellectual disability (IQ 40-70) and 3-4 active carious lesions were randomized into two groups: Group 1 received SDF and Group 2 received NSF. Saliva samples were collected at baseline and after one month to assess and counts. Clinical evaluation of caries arrest was performed at one, three, and six months. Results Both SDF and NSF significantly reduced the number of active carious lesions and salivary bacterial counts within groups (p < 0.001), with no statistically significant difference between groups at any interval (p > 0.05). NSF demonstrated comparable efficacy to SDF in both primary and permanent teeth. Notably, NSF did not cause black staining, offering a more aesthetic option, especially for anterior teeth. Conclusion NSF is an effective, safe, and visually favorable alternative to SDF for caries management in CSHCN.

摘要

引言

龋齿仍然是一个重大的公共卫生问题,尤其是在有特殊医疗需求的儿童中,由于口腔卫生维护方面的挑战以及获得牙科护理的机会有限,他们面临的风险更高。氟化亚银(SDF)被广泛用于阻止龋齿,但会导致不良的黑色染色。纳米氟化银(NSF)已作为一种潜在的替代物被引入,它能有效管理龋齿且无美学缺陷。因此,这项随机对照临床试验旨在评估和比较NSF和SDF对4至12岁有特殊医疗需求儿童(CSHCN)的防龋和抗菌效果。

方法

42名轻度至中度智力残疾(智商40 - 70)且有3 - 4个活动性龋损的儿童被随机分为两组:第1组接受SDF,第2组接受NSF。在基线和1个月后收集唾液样本以评估 和 计数。在1、3和6个月时对龋齿停止情况进行临床评估。

结果

SDF和NSF均显著减少了组内活动性龋损的数量和唾液细菌计数(p < 0.001),在任何时间段两组之间均无统计学显著差异(p > 0.05)。NSF在乳牙和恒牙中均显示出与SDF相当的疗效。值得注意的是,NSF没有导致黑色染色,提供了一种更美观的选择,尤其是对于前牙。

结论

对于CSHCN的龋齿管理,NSF是一种有效、安全且外观良好的SDF替代物。
